FHFA HPI release change

What changed in the latest House Price Index year

2023 -> 2024
  • FHFA House Price Index values in ZIP 05478 (Saint Albans, VT) rose +5.8% from 2023 to 2024. The all-transactions index moved from 282.3 in 2023 to 298.7 in 2024 (2000 = 100).

Arithmetic difference between stored FHFA all-transactions ZIP House Price Index annual values - a developmental index from repeat sales and appraisals, not a transaction median, appraisal opinion, or forecast. Thin markets can move sharply.

ZIP code 05478 is a mid-sized community (a standard USPS delivery area) in Saint Albans, Franklin County, Vermont, home to 14,449 residents across 156.7 square miles, a density of 92 people per square mile, in the New York time zone.

ZIP 05478 lands in the middle-income range, with a median household income of $71,203 (14% below the average Vermont ZIP), while per-capita income is $41,852. The poverty rate is 12.2%, with unemployment at 1.6%; those measures add context to the income figure. Median home value is $316,400 (1% above the average Vermont ZIP) and median rent is $1,227; 68.1% of occupied homes are owner-occupied.

A solid share of residents have a four-year degree: 31.0%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, the median age is 40.8, and the average commute is 25 minutes. What businesses operate in this ZIP?

Census Bureau data shows 476 business establishments in ZIP 05478, employing approximately 7,999 people with a combined annual payroll of $392,084,000.
